21 +//__"Topic Full" alert restriction changed__//
22 +With this release, we will change the "Topic Full" trigger point in our standard set of alerts once a model uses the Event Streaming functionality. Before, the alert would trigger on 80%, but as we saw, this is too early to make the alert useful in the context of our customers. As a result, the threshold has been raised to 95% to accommodate real-life situations better.

56 -{{info}}Note the following limitations when working with the debugger.
57 - * Your entire model needs to be migrated to the 3rd generation runtime
58 - * Only **one** flow **per** runtime can be debugged **per** environment
59 - * There is only **one** overview in which **all** debugged messages are shown
60 - * Message payload in excess of 100KB are not shown in the queue browser as they constitute a "large message"
61 - * The debug functionality works for a period of five minutes in which you can use the refresh button to see new messages coming in.
62 - ** After five minutes the debug functionality will be shutdown automatically under water.
63 - ** To see new messages after the five minutes you will have to access the debug functionality again from scratch.{{/info}}
